SteamClock Vancouver captures one of Vancouver’s most recognizable landmarks through Kamiar Gajoum’s distinctive blend of atmosphere, romance, and light. Bathed in warm amber reflections against a misty evening sky, the historic Gastown Steam Clock stands as a timeless symbol of the city’s character and heritage.
The glowing storefronts, elegant street lamps, and strolling couple create a cinematic scene that celebrates both the energy and intimacy of urban life. Through expressive brushwork and luminous colour contrasts, Gajoum transforms a familiar Vancouver streetscape into a poetic moment suspended between memory and imagination.
